Job Description

"The Construction Preapprenticeship program prepares individuals to enter a short-term training program that leads to a rewarding career pathway. It combines college coursework, mentoring, and paid wages ($14-$15) per hour. Preapprentices receive free tuition, Free books, and health insurance while on-the-job training. During classroom instruction, participants will learn OSHA safety, blueprint reading, tool usage and other trade skills for a job in construction. Upon program completion, apprentices will receive a nationally recognized Certificate of Completion, with the opportunity of earning an industry recognized credential.


The Plumber Preapprenticeship in construction is a 1-year program designed for persons who would like to learn about installing, repairing, and maintaining, pipes, valves, and drainage systems. Students in this program receive instruction in basic plumbing knowledge, safe workplace practices, proper use of plumbing and power tools, and how to install a variety of piping and plumbing fixtures.
